Output 93dc64443d34262fea6e5171ef8ce455bcfe1c163d4795f106cd72dadc5a8eb4:1

value
3635925
script pubkey
OP_0 OP_PUSHBYTES_20 de30331eaf3b8879476ba88ce4a82689c7c3dd31
address
bc1qmccrx8408wy8j3mt4zxwf2px38ru8hf3gx8n3n
transaction
93dc64443d34262fea6e5171ef8ce455bcfe1c163d4795f106cd72dadc5a8eb4